Origins and Foundation:

Black Cube was founded in 2010 by a group of former Israeli intelligence officers, adding a layer of mystique to its already secretive nature. These founders brought with them a wealth of expertise and experience in intelligence gathering, creating an agency that rapidly gained a reputation for its effectiveness in facts procurement.

Notable Cases:

Black Cube has been involved in various high-profile instances that have brought it into the limelight:

Weinstein Scandal: In 2017, it was revealed that Black Cube had been hired by Harvey Weinstein, the disgraced Hollywood producer, to investigate and undermine ladies who accused him of sexual harassment and assault. This revelation shocked the planet and ignited a debate about the ethics of using private intelligence agencies for such purposes.
